Athabasca Oil Corporation Fundamental Analysis

Athabasca Oil Corporation (ATH.TO) shows moderate financial fundamentals with a PE ratio of 22.03, profit margin of 18.29%, and ROE of 13.86%. The company generates $1.3B in annual revenue with strong year-over-year growth of 20.67%.
